HI,
I'm using an X41T since 2 years, one year with windows and one using Ubuntu.
When I was using windows the life of the extended battery was of about 5/6
hours (without wireless), after some time I have installed linux, one month
of usage under linux and the system advices me of the degraded battery
condition. So under windows the battery was reduced to 2 and a half hous and
under linux 1 and an half (at the start it was 3 hours).

So I bought a new battery, the normal (small not extended), at the start
under windows the life was about 2.45h and under linux 1.15h.
After one month of usage only under linux the life was degraded, under
windws  1.15h and under linux 40minutes.

I tried to use the TP_smapi modules on the new battery to prevent damages to
battery customizing the charge, but no way, now is almost unusable.

Now is one year that I'm triyng to solve the problem, I love the X41T and I
will buy a new battery but I don't want to trash my money again.

I have seen looking under : /sys/devices/platform/smapi/BAT0/power_now that
often under linux is drined more then 16-18W, with peaks of 20-21W (using
the battery not charging).
The battery is designed to give no more then 14W, is it possible that the
problem under linux is that there are not IBM drivers that manage the power
drain preventing it to excheed the 14W limit of the battery?

I know the tipical advices on how to mantain a battery, the point is that
for sure the battery are died cause of a wrong power managing under linux,
but actually I don't know what to do to solve the problem.
